The U.S. Census Bureau definition of Asians as "Asian” refers to a person having origins in any of the original peoples of the Far East, Southeast Asia, or the Indian subcontinent, including, for example, Bangladesh, Cambodia, China, India, Japan, Korea, Malaysia, Pakistan, the Philippine Islands, Thailand, and Vietnam. It includes people who indicated their race(s) as "Asian" or reported entries such as "Asian Indian," "Chinese," "Filipino," "Korean," "Japanese," "Vietnamese," and "Other Asian" or provided other detailed Asian responses". They comprise 4.8% of the U.S. population alone, while people who are Asian combined with at least one other race make up 5.6%. Template:/box-footer

Asian Americans having historically been in the territory that would become the United States since the 16th century have experienced difficulties in the past in immigrating to, and becoming naturalized citizens. This article lists legislation, as well as judicial rulings, which restricted and expanded immigration from Asia.

Director-producer Areeya Chumsai attends the Thai press preview for Ploy at SF World in CentralWorld, Bangkok.

Areeya Chumsai (Thai: อารียา ชุมสาย; nicknamed "Pop"(Thai: ป็อป, born June 28, 1971) is a Thai-American model, teacher and filmmaker.
